Mr. Mele Kyari, the GCEO of NNPC limited has restated the role of natural gas in propelling economic growth and industrialization of Nigeria.
He stated this during a book launch in Abuja. The book, “The Rise of Gas: From Gaslink to the Decade of Gas” written by Charles A. Osezua, put a spotlight on gas and its global acceptance as an important energy source to fuel economic development.
The Chief Corporate Communication Officer of NNPC Limited, Olufemi Soneye, had on Wednesday, on the company’s official X (twitter) handle quoted the GCEO, Mr. Kyari, as emphasizing the need to prioritize natural gas production in the country.
“This is especially crucial given the geopolitical dynamics and energy security concerns in the global economy,” the chief officer of the company said.
The NNPC helmsman who was represented at the book launch by Mrs. Oluwakemi Olumuyiwa, Head of Relationship and Stakeholder Management at NNPCL emphasised the significance of appropriately documenting Nigeria’s gas sector.
“The book aligns with the Federal Government’s ‘Decade of Gas’ initiative, aimed at optimizing Nigeria’s abundant gas reserves for both domestic consumption and international export.
“As a key stakeholder, NNPC Ltd. has played a leading role in advancing the ‘Decade of Gas’ agenda through strategic investments in critical gas infrastructure such as pipelines and processing facilities.”
The author, Osezua, in his Remark at the launch of the book, “The Rise of Gas” said it is his contribution to Nigeria’s energy literature, while thanking the NNPCL for their support towards the launch of the book. “NNPC’s participation at this launch underscores the company’s commitment to fostering knowledge sharing and innovation within the gas industry.” the author concluded.
